STEUBEN COUNTY, Ind. (WKZO-AM) — Police agencies in three states are looking for a Branch County couple for a string of bank robberies and other heists.
Steuben County, Ind., alone has issued seven-count warrants seeking John Morgan and Nickole Collins for three counts of bank robbery, three counts of unarmed robbery and a count of conspiracy.
The couple is are also suspected in pulling off a string of armed robberies in Michigan, Ohio and Indiana.
Investigators say both are known to frequent Branch and St. Joseph counties in Michigan.
Morgan is a 5-foot-10, 32-year-old who weights 195 pounds. He has brown hair, hazel eyes, a tattoo of deer antlers on his left forearm and an unknown tattoo on his right forearm.
His alleged partner in crime, 29-year-old Nickole Collins, is 5-foot-5 and 180 pounds with brown hair and blue eyes. She has a Tattoo of the Scorpio sign on the back of her neck and the name of her alleged accomplice, “Morgan,” inked on her left wrist.
They’re considered armed and dangerous. Anyone who sees them is asked to call 911 or local police.
UPDATE – 4/4 at 7:55 a.m.: Both John Morgan and Nickole Collins have been captured near Cincinnati.
